    The Royal Palace Museum, a gem located in the heart of Genoa, is an essential stop for any traveler seeking to delve into the rich historical and cultural tapestry of this Italian city. Originally built as a residence for the wealthy Balbi family in the 17th century, this grand palace is now a museum that showcases remarkable collections of art, furniture, and decorative items, reflecting the opulence and sophistication of the Genoese nobility. As you stroll through its elegantly decorated rooms, you'll encounter masterpieces by renowned artists, including paintings and sculptures that highlight the artistic heritage of the region. One of the most striking features of the museum is its stunning architecture, which harmoniously blends Baroque and Neoclassical styles. The grand staircases and lavish halls create an inviting atmosphere, making it easy to imagine the splendor of courtly life in centuries past. The museum also offers a glimpse into the history of the Royal House of Savoy, providing context to the political and cultural shifts that have shaped Genoa over the years. Beyond the museum's interior, the beautifully landscaped gardens provide a tranquil escape, where visitors can enjoy the lush greenery and stunning views of the city.
